Common Crafting Milestones
| Level | Item | XP per Item | Requirement |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Leather Gloves | 13.8 | 1 Leather |
| 7 | Gold Ring | 15.0 | 1 Gold Bar |
| 20 | Sapphire Ring | 40.0 | 1 Gold Bar, 1 Sapphire |
| 33 | Vial | 35.0 | 1 Molten Glass |
| 46 | Glass Lantern Lens | 55.0 | 1 Molten Glass |
| 63 | Green D'hide Body | 186.0 | 3 Green D'hide |
| 77 | Red D'hide Body | 234.0 | 3 Red D'hide |
| 84 | Black D'hide Body | 258.0 | 3 Black D'hide |
| 99 | Skillcape | – | Mastery |

Common misconceptions include the idea that Crafting is always a "money sink." While many fast methods like Dragonhide bodies cost significant gold, methods like blowing glass or crafting certain jewelry can actually be profitable or break-even, especially when considering the osrs gold per xp ratio.
Crafting Calculator OSRS Formula and Mathematical Explanation
The math behind our crafting calculator osrs is straightforward but vital for planning. We use the official OSRS experience table to determine the gap between your current standing and your goal.
The Core Formula:
Items Needed = (Target XP – Current XP) / XP per Item
Total Cost = Items Needed * (Material Cost – Item Sale Price)
GP/XP = Total Cost / (Target XP – Current XP)

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Example 1: Level 63 to 70 with Green Dragonhide Bodies
If a player is at level 63 (368,599 XP) and wants to reach level 70 (737,627 XP), they need 369,028 XP. Using Green Dragonhide Bodies (186 XP each), the crafting calculator osrs determines they need 1,985 bodies. If the loss per body is 200 GP, the total cost is 397,000 GP.
Example 2: Level 1 to 99 with Molten Glass (Ironman Style)
An osrs ironman crafting player starting from level 1 needs 13,034,431 XP. If they choose to blow glass into Light Orbs (70 XP each) from level 87 onwards, the calculator helps them track the thousands of buckets of sand and soda ash required to reach the 99 milestone.

Key Factors That Affect Crafting Calculator OSRS Results
- Grand Exchange Volatility: Prices for dragonhides and battlestaves change daily, affecting your total profit or loss.
- Tick Manipulation: While the calculator shows items needed, your XP per hour depends on how many "ticks" each action takes.
- Ironman Restrictions: Ironmen cannot buy materials, so the "cost" is measured in time spent gathering sand or killing dragons.
- Bonus XP Events: OSRS does not have "Double XP" weekends, but certain minigames or quests might provide one-time XP rewards.
- Failing to Craft: At lower levels, some items (like certain jewelry) have a failure rate, though most primary training methods have a 100% success rate.
- Level Requirements: Always check the crafting level requirements before buying bulk materials to ensure you can actually craft the item.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the fastest crafting xp osrs?
The fastest XP is generally crafting Dragonhide bodies (Black D'hide being the highest) or cutting high-level gems like Diamonds or Dragonstones.
Is Crafting profitable in OSRS?
Yes, certain methods like crafting Gold Bracelets, Bowstrings (at very low levels), or specific jewelry can yield a profit, though they are slower than expensive methods.
How much does 99 Crafting cost?
Using the crafting calculator osrs, you'll find that 99 via Air Battlestaves costs roughly 20-30m, while Dragonhides can cost upwards of 80-100m depending on market prices.
Does this calculator work for F2P?
Yes, simply select F2P items like Silver Tiara or Gold Jewelry from the list and adjust the prices accordingly.
What are the best osrs crafting level requirements for quests?
Level 70 is a common requirement for many high-level quests, including Song of the Elves.
